The Christmas Day Explosion
On December 25, 2020, a massive explosion rocked Second Avenue North. The blast originated from a parked RV, which had been broadcasting a warning message prior to the detonation. The explosion caused widespread damage to buildings and infrastructure in the immediate vicinity.
Aftermath and Damage
In the wake of the explosion, the extent of the damage became apparent. Buildings were heavily damaged, with facades collapsing and windows shattered. The street was littered with debris, and emergency services responded to the scene to assess the damage and provide assistance.
Key Points of Damage:
- Building Collapses: Several buildings sustained significant structural damage, with partial or complete collapses.
- Infrastructure Damage: The explosion damaged underground utilities, including water and gas lines.
- Debris Field: The area was covered in debris, making it difficult for emergency responders to navigate.
